Then, you might just have met the culinary challenge of your dreams. Plan a trip to The Grill on the Hill to take on the Cliffhanger food challenge.
The Grill on the Hill, a quaint restaurant in New Castle, serves breakfast, lunch, and dinner. Having a special event? They'll cater it for you, too.
But, if you like a challenge, you're likely ready to take on the Cliffhanger Challenge. Do it alone or bring along your best buds to race the clock with you.
Challenge winners receive bragging rights, of course, but that's not all. Beat the clock to finish your meal and your meal is free. Your name will also adorn the Challenge Wall and you'll get a t-shirt to show off your culinary accomplishment.
Ready to take on the Cliffhanger Challenge? The Grill on the Hill welcomes guests Tuesday through Saturday from 7 a.m. to 7 p.m. and Sunday from 8 a.m. to 5 p.m.
